Peanut Butter Stuffed Chocolate Brownie French Toast

  • Prep Time:15 minutes
  • Cook Time:5 minutes
  • Total Time:20 minutes
  • Servings:2
  • Medium

    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up low fat/skim milk
  • 2 tablespoon un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 2 tablespoon raw s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
  • 4 slices of your bread of choice (sweet, white, grain or sourdough)
  • 1 tablespoon creamy peanut butter
  • 3 tablespoon cream cheese, at room temperature
  • 1 tablespoon maple syrup (or sugar)
  • Crushed nuts

  • Step 1

    First, whisk together the milk, cocoa powder and sugar until dissolved. It’s okay if there are still small lumps. Add in the egg and the vanilla, and continue to whisk until everything is combined. Set aside.

  • Step 2

    Add the peanut butter, cream cheese, and syrup to a small bowl and whisk together to make the peanut butter cheesecake mix.

  • Step 3

    Divide the ‘cheesecake’ mixture between two pieces of bread, and spread them with the mixture.

  • Step 4

    Top with remaining bread slices. Dip each ‘sandwich’ into the chocolate egg wash. Turn to evenly coat.

  • Step 5

    Heat a nonstick pan/griddle over medium heat and lightly grease with butter.

  • Step 6

    Cover pan with a lid. Fry on both sides until a darker brown and firm to the touch on the outside, and cooked through.

  • Step 7

    Serve and sprinkle crushed nuts.
